Living with SIN (part 2)
Previously, I posted about how Dinah went to Asia to learn to be Shiva and instead remembered who Black Canary is. She also met a little girl named Sin who was going to be trained as the next Shiva. Dinah instead brought her back to the US as her daughter. Here I post Sin's next four (and last) appearances in Birds of Prey. From #96, #98, #100, and #109.

This next bit is from BoP #100. The actual story is 15 pages long and involves Dinah and Sin packing up and Dinah explaining her relationship with her mother to Sin. It's a bit complicated to post so I say just go check it out, but I included a few bits involving Dinah explaining her relationship with Ollie as that becomes very important very soon.


Cue montage of basically all of Dinah and Ollie's history up until that kiss with Marianne, with Dinah saying that Ollie hurt her badly.



Hmm, that shot about "taken in an orphan girl to boot!" reminds me that there has been a surprising lack of Mia on the new s_d. Although I wouldn't exactly describe her as an orphan girl.

And finally we get to BoP #109, after Ollie has proposed to Dinah but before she says yes. The issue is basically Babs trying to talk Dinah out of it, but there is cute Sin as well:
